Access Description: Travel south of Timmins on Pine Street for 3 km to the DeSantis road and then west for 2 km to the site. The site lies north east of the road.
1910: discovery by Gray brothers. 1911-16: Hollinger Reserve Mining Company/Porcupine Crown Mines Limited - shaft to 200 ft, winze to 318 ft., diamond drilling. 1920-23: McEnaney Gold Mines, Limited - de-watering of workings; winze deepened, diamond drilling (3500 ft). 1934-39: Sun-Ray Gold Syndicate - property acquisition, sampling. 1936: Hollinger Consolidated Gold MInes Limited - property optioned, 1 ddh. 2000: Echo Bay Mines Ltd. - mapping, sampling. 2003: Porcupine Joint Venture: airborne geophysics.

Dec 07, 2005 (A Wilson) - The occurence consists of a minimum of 3 quartz veins hosted by sheared intermediate to mafic metavolcanic rocks.

Dec 07, 2005 (A Wilson) - The vein at the bottom of the winze reportedly carried $1.26 Au per ton in gold across a width of six feet at the 600-ft level, and $0.20 at the 850-ft level. Reports of underground samples collected in 1911 returned assays of $20.0 Au over 3 ft. Grab samples collected from the mine dump in 1934 returned assays ranging from trace to $8.00 Au. The best assay reported by Hollinger in 1936 returned 0.46 oz/t Au.
